Step-By-Step Instructions For Enable Macros In Excel Not Working
close

Step-By-Step Instructions For Enable Macros In Excel Not Working

3 min read 24-01-2025
Step-By-Step Instructions For Enable Macros In Excel Not Working

Enabling macros in Excel is crucial for utilizing many powerful features, but sometimes you run into issues. This guide provides comprehensive, step-by-step instructions to troubleshoot why macro enabling might not be working, along with solutions for common problems.

Understanding Macro Security Settings

Before diving into solutions, it's essential to understand Excel's macro security settings. These settings determine how Excel handles macros, balancing functionality with security. Incorrect settings are the most frequent reason why enabling macros fails.

The Three Main Macro Security Levels:

  • Disable all macros without notification: This is the most secure setting, preventing all macros from running. It's a good default if you rarely use macros or download files from untrusted sources.

  • Disable all macros with notification: Excel will alert you when a workbook contains macros. You can then choose to enable or disable them individually. This offers a balance between security and functionality.

  • Enable all macros (not recommended): This setting enables all macros automatically. While convenient, it's highly risky and makes your computer vulnerable to malware. Avoid this setting unless you are absolutely certain of the source and safety of all your Excel files.

Troubleshooting Steps: Why Macros Aren't Enabling

Let's address the common scenarios preventing macro enablement:

1. Incorrect Security Settings:

  • Check your Excel Macro Security: Open Excel, go to File > Options > Trust Center > Trust Center Settings > Macro Settings. Select either "Disable all macros with notification" or "Enable all macros (not recommended - proceed with extreme caution!)". Restart Excel to ensure the changes take effect.

2. The "Developer" Tab is Missing:

The Developer tab, which contains macro-related tools, is often hidden by default.

  • Unhide the Developer Tab: Go to File > Options > Customize Ribbon. In the right panel, under "Main Tabs," check the box next to "Developer." Click "OK." The Developer tab will now appear in the Excel ribbon.

3. Corrupted Excel File:

A corrupted Excel file can prevent macros from working correctly.

  • Try Opening in Safe Mode: Start Excel in safe mode (search for "Excel" and hold down Ctrl while clicking). If the macros work in safe mode, your main Excel file is likely corrupted. Try creating a new workbook and copying your macro code there. If the problem persists, consider repairing the file using a specialized Excel repair tool (available online).

4. Antivirus or Firewall Interference:

Your antivirus software or firewall might be blocking the macro execution.

  • Temporarily Disable Security Software (Use Caution!): Temporarily disable your antivirus or firewall. Try enabling the macro again. If it works, re-enable your security software and configure it to allow Excel to execute macros from trusted sources. Be extremely careful when disabling security software; only do it briefly and only if you trust the source of the Excel file.

5. Digital Signatures:

Macros from untrusted sources might lack digital signatures, preventing their execution. Digital signatures verify the authenticity and integrity of the macro code.

  • Examine Macro Source: If possible, obtain macros from trusted sources that provide digitally signed macros.

6. Outdated Excel Version:

Older versions of Excel might have compatibility issues with newer macros.

  • Update Microsoft Office: Make sure you have the latest version of Microsoft Office installed. Updates often include security patches and bug fixes that could solve this issue.

7. Permission Issues:

You might lack the necessary permissions to enable macros.

  • Administrative Privileges: Try running Excel as an administrator (right-click the Excel icon and select "Run as administrator").

Beyond the Basics: Advanced Troubleshooting

If the above steps don't resolve your issue, consider these:

  • Check the VBA Editor (Alt + F11): Examine the VBA code for errors. Syntax errors or other coding issues can prevent macros from running.
  • Reinstall Microsoft Office: As a last resort, reinstalling Microsoft Office can fix underlying software problems.
  • Consult Microsoft Support: If none of the above helps, seek assistance from Microsoft support or online Excel communities.

By systematically working through these troubleshooting steps, you should be able to successfully enable macros in Excel. Remember to always prioritize security and only enable macros from trusted sources.

a.b.c.d.e.f.g.h.